php删除txt文件指定行及按行读取txt文档数据的方法

yipeiwu_com6年前PHP代码库

本文实例讲述了php删除txt文件指定行及按行读取txt文档数据的方法。分享给大家供大家参考,具体如下:

向txt文件循环写入值:

$keys = range(1,999);
$file = fopen('key_11010000.txt',"w");
foreach($keys as $key){
  fwrite($file,"$key\r\n");
}
fclose($file);
$f1 = fopen('key_11010000.txt','r');
while(!feof($f1)){
  $line=fgets($f1);
  $line = trim($line);
  $arr[] = $line;
}
$keys = array_filter($arr);
var_dump($keys);

按行读取txt文档数据:

$f1 = fopen('key_11010000.txt','r');
while(!feof($f1)){
  $line=fgets($f1);
  $line = trim($line);
  $arr[] = $line;
}
$keys = array_filter($arr);
var_dump($keys);
die;

更多关于PHP相关内容感兴趣的读者可查看本站专题:《php文件操作总结》、《php字符串(string)用法总结》、《PHP常用遍历算法与技巧总结》、《php正则表达式用法总结》、《PHP运算与运算符用法总结》、《PHP基本语法入门教程》、《php面向对象程序设计入门教程》、《php+mysql数据库操作入门教程》及《php常见数据库操作技巧汇总

希望本文所述对大家PHP程序设计有所帮助。

相关文章

PHP substr 截取字符串出现乱码问题解决方法[utf8与gb2312]

substr --- 取得部份字符串 语法 : string substr (string string, int start [, int length]) 说明 : substr(...

jQuery+PHP发布的内容进行无刷新分页(Fckeditor)

jQuery+PHP发布的内容进行无刷新分页(Fckeditor)

这篇文章将使用jQuery,并结合PHP,将Fckeditor发布的内容进行分页,并且实现无刷新切换页面。  本文假设你是WEB开发人员,掌握了jQuery和PHP相关知识,并...

php合并数组中相同元素的方法

本文实例讲述了php合并数组中相同元素的方法。分享给大家供大家参考。具体如下: 关于重复数组的删除我们都介绍过N种方法了,今天这个例子有点不同就是 删除数组中相同的元素,只保留一个相同元...

PHP的Yii框架的常用日志操作总结

日志 Yii提供了一个高度自定义化和高扩展性的日志框架。根据使用场景的不同,你可以很容易的对各种消息就行记录、过滤、合并,比如说文本文件,数据库文件,邮件。 使用Yii的日志框架包含如下...

一个PHP缓存类代码(附详细说明)

复制代码 代码如下: <?php define('CACHE_ROOT', dirname(__FILE__).'/cache'); //缓存存放目录 define('CACHE_...